| CVE-2015-4164 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| The compat_iret function in Xen 3.1 through 4.5 iterates the wrong way through a loop, which allows local 32-bit PV guest administrators to cause a denial of service (large loop and system hang) via a hypercall_iret call with EFLAGS.VM set. | ||||
| CVE-2015-8550 | 2 Novell, Xen | 2 Suse Linux Enterprise Real Time Extension, Xen | 2025-04-12 | N/A |
| Xen, when used on a system providing PV backends, allows local guest OS administrators to cause a denial of service (host OS crash) or gain privileges by writing to memory shared between the frontend and backend, aka a double fetch vulnerability. | ||||
| CVE-2015-8553 | 2 Redhat, Xen | 2 Enterprise Linux, Xen | 2025-04-12 | N/A |
| Xen allows guest OS users to obtain sensitive information from uninitialized locations in host OS kernel memory by not enabling memory and I/O decoding control bits. NOTE: this vulnerability exists because of an incomplete fix for CVE-2015-0777. | ||||
| CVE-2015-8555 | 2 Citrix, Xen | 2 Xenserver, Xen | 2025-04-12 | N/A |
| Xen 4.6.x, 4.5.x, 4.4.x, 4.3.x, and earlier do not initialize x86 FPU stack and XMM registers when XSAVE/XRSTOR are not used to manage guest extended register state, which allows local guest domains to obtain sensitive information from other domains via unspecified vectors. | ||||
| CVE-2015-4163 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| GNTTABOP_swap_grant_ref in Xen 4.2 through 4.5 does not check the grant table operation version, which allows local guest domains to cause a denial of service (NULL pointer dereference) via a hypercall without a GNTTABOP_setup_table or GNTTABOP_set_version. | ||||
| CVE-2016-3159 | 4 Debian, Fedoraproject, Oracle and 1 more | 4 Debian Linux, Fedora, Vm Server and 1 more | 2025-04-12 | N/A |
| The fpu_fxrstor function in arch/x86/i387.c in Xen 4.x does not properly handle writes to the hardware FSW.ES bit when running on AMD64 processors, which allows local guest OS users to obtain sensitive register content information from another guest by leveraging pending exception and mask bits. NOTE: this vulnerability exists because of an incorrect fix for CVE-2013-2076. | ||||
| CVE-2015-0361 | 2 Opensuse, Xen | 2 Opensuse, Xen | 2025-04-12 | N/A |
| Use-after-free vulnerability in Xen 4.2.x, 4.3.x, and 4.4.x allows remote domains to cause a denial of service (system crash) via a crafted hypercall during HVM guest teardown. | ||||
| CVE-2015-4105 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| Xen 3.3.x through 4.5.x enables logging for PCI MSI-X pass-through error messages, which allows local x86 HVM guests to cause a denial of service (host disk consumption) via certain invalid operations. | ||||
| CVE-2016-4963 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| The libxl device-handling in Xen through 4.6.x allows local guest OS users with access to the driver domain to cause a denial of service (management tool confusion) by manipulating information in the backend directories in xenstore. | ||||
| CVE-2016-7777 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| Xen 4.7.x and earlier does not properly honor CR0.TS and CR0.EM, which allows local x86 HVM guest OS users to read or modify FPU, MMX, or XMM register state information belonging to arbitrary tasks on the guest by modifying an instruction while the hypervisor is preparing to emulate it. | ||||
| CVE-2016-6259 | 2 Citrix, Xen | 2 Xenserver, Xen | 2025-04-12 | N/A |
| Xen 4.5.x through 4.7.x do not implement Supervisor Mode Access Prevention (SMAP) whitelisting in 32-bit exception and event delivery, which allows local 32-bit PV guest OS kernels to cause a denial of service (hypervisor and VM crash) by triggering a safety check. | ||||
| CVE-2016-7092 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| The get_page_from_l3e function in arch/x86/mm.c in Xen allows local 32-bit PV guest OS administrators to gain host OS privileges via vectors related to L3 recursive pagetables. | ||||
| CVE-2016-7094 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| Buffer overflow in Xen 4.7.x and earlier allows local x86 HVM guest OS administrators on guests running with shadow paging to cause a denial of service via a pagetable update. | ||||
| CVE-2016-7154 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| Use-after-free vulnerability in the FIFO event channel code in Xen 4.4.x allows local guest OS administrators to cause a denial of service (host crash) and possibly execute arbitrary code or obtain sensitive information via an invalid guest frame number. | ||||
| CVE-2015-3259 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| Stack-based buffer overflow in the xl command line utility in Xen 4.1.x through 4.5.x allows local guest administrators to gain privileges via a long configuration argument. | ||||
| CVE-2015-2756 | 4 Canonical, Debian, Fedoraproject and 1 more | 4 Ubuntu Linux, Debian Linux, Fedora and 1 more | 2025-04-12 | N/A |
| QEMU, as used in Xen 3.3.x through 4.5.x, does not properly restrict access to PCI command registers, which might allow local HVM guest users to cause a denial of service (non-maskable interrupt and host crash) by disabling the (1) memory or (2) I/O decoding for a PCI Express device and then accessing the device, which triggers an Unsupported Request (UR) response. | ||||
| CVE-2015-2044 | 1 Xen | 1 Xen | 2025-04-12 | N/A |
| The emulation routines for unspecified X86 devices in Xen 3.2.x through 4.5.x does not properly initialize data, which allow local HVM guest users to obtain sensitive information via vectors involving an unsupported access size. | ||||
| CVE-2014-9030 | 3 Debian, Opensuse, Xen | 3 Debian Linux, Opensuse, Xen | 2025-04-12 | N/A |
| The do_mmu_update function in arch/x86/mm.c in Xen 3.2.x through 4.4.x does not properly manage page references, which allows remote domains to cause a denial of service by leveraging control over an HVM guest and a crafted MMU_MACHPHYS_UPDATE. | ||||
| CVE-2014-8867 | 4 Debian, Opensuse, Redhat and 1 more | 5 Debian Linux, Opensuse, Enterprise Linux and 2 more | 2025-04-12 | N/A |
| The acceleration support for the "REP MOVS" instruction in Xen 4.4.x, 3.2.x, and earlier lacks properly bounds checking for memory mapped I/O (MMIO) emulated in the hypervisor, which allows local HVM guests to cause a denial of service (host crash) via unspecified vectors. | ||||
| CVE-2014-8595 | 3 Debian, Opensuse, Xen | 3 Debian Linux, Opensuse, Xen | 2025-04-12 | N/A |
| arch/x86/x86_emulate/x86_emulate.c in Xen 3.2.1 through 4.4.x does not properly check privileges, which allows local HVM guest users to gain privileges or cause a denial of service (crash) via a crafted (1) CALL, (2) JMP, (3) RETF, (4) LCALL, (5) LJMP, or (6) LRET far branch instruction. | ||||
